## Onboarding: Quickfill autocomplete index

Quickfill's autocomplete index rebuilds nightly. When users report slow or stale suggestions, check the rebuild job first — a stuck rebuild is the cause 90% of the time. Restarting the indexer requires pushing a job manifest to the Brindlehost scheduler. Manifests are rejected unless signed; support has its own scoped deploy identity for this, separate from engineering's. Do not reuse personal credentials. The deploy key authorized for support-initiated index restarts is listed directly below.

rollout seal: bky4_yke3

# Break-Glass: Catalog Cache Invalidation

Scope: the Pinrow product catalog at Veldstone Retail. If stale prices persist after a purge and the Hollowmere invalidation queue is wedged, use break-glass to flush the edge tier directly. Contractors: get verbal sign-off from the catalog lead first. Steps: open the Hollowmere admin shell, select emergency-flush, confirm the tenant, and run it once — repeated flushes thrash the origin. Access is logged and expires after 20 minutes. Unseal the admin shell with the passphrase below.

recovery phrase for kahop-tajog: istix-casvan

**Key Ceremony — Step 4 (GiveNote Receipt Mailer)**

Verify the GiveNote mailer signing key is present on the offline laptop. Confirm two witnesses. Rotate the DKIM pair, archive the old key, seal the envelope, log the timestamp. Do not connect to network until sealed. Unsealing the backup envelope later requires the recovery passphrase, which is:

recovery phrase for hafop-kadup: quenath-fendor